When King Louis XIV decided to no longer perform in the court ballets himself, a decisive turning point in dance history occurred: social court dance and professional stage dance henceforth developed along their own paths. From the elegant Danses de Bal to the highly demanding Entrées, a rich and fascinating repertoire from this era has been preserved for us. The couple and solo dances of the Baroque are characterized by an incomparable grace. They bring the entire body into a harmonious unison, where supple footwork and stylish arm movements merge into perfect unity.
